180 + 50% = 270. Not to mention the owner said he did a few modifications as well.



Boost at 3000RPM, even your peak boost target at 3000RPM is good for a turbocharger but it is not near peak torque right off of idle nor is it peak boost at 1500RPM. You are also forgetting a few things, peak boost does not mean peak torque, there is also a thing called boost response which is how fast your turbo spools when you are off the throttle and your already at the rpms your turbo would spool up then you step on the accelerator in addition you have throttle response which is how fast the charge pipes and intercooler fill up to volume before your intake becomes pressurized and you start putting the power to the ground. These are all areas where the supercharger has a big advantage, its not just the powerband below 3000RPMs. Your going to tell me about turbo sizing and how flat the torque curve is? Somewhat semantics. 170 whp + 60% = 272 hp. Do you realize that on other engines that would still be a pretty phenomenal acheivement. 300 hp Mustang = 480 hp, or a 400 hp Corvette = 640 hp, or even an 240 hp S2000 = 384 hp, or 287 hp 350Z = 459 hp. This is on an NA engine. Pretty damn mammouth acheivement if you ask me. Especially for $2900 for the kit. One issue I have with the Pettit is that when it first was going to come out they were saying $5000, even now they are targeting the retail price of the Greddy of $4200. That is still steep.

For a car that revs to 9000, 2500-3000 RPM is pretty much right off idle, and time to boost is literally instantaneous given the fact that the kit is running 6-7 psi max. It's not like we have to go off vacuum & push 19 psi through the kit & wait. Literally I step on the gas & I get full boost.

Greddy is putting out 240 whp (Philodox from RXTuner article & a baseline of 180 whp), the PTP is putting out 274 whp (about 30-35 whp difference, not 60 whp). the difference can be the size & design of the turbo, the size of the IC, the A/F, etc.

Boost is not boost. A larger turbo can flow air more efficiently so it creates less heat therefore more air flow with the same level of pressure will create more HP.

Pressure is pressure in the intake manifold. I haven't heard of any accuracy problems due to sensor mounting however there can be accuracy problems with the type of gauge used. I no longer use autometer, at least not the cheap ones because my autometer boost gauge was off 0-2 psi all the time compared to the sensor readings on my ECU. 2 psi can be a pretty big difference between just right and too much boost. The screws (not vanes) in the autorotor don't have a 2:1 ratio. It is more like a 7:5 or 6:4 or something. The male and female rotors have a different number or lobes.
